MINUTES — Management Meeting, Pellicker Goods
Present: sales leads, ops

Decision: the Tarnsley office closes end of quarter. Three staff relocate to the Brindham hub; one role ends. Accounts transfer to the central team. Client notifications go out next week — keep messaging consistent. Lease exit handled by finance. No further closures planned this year. Confidential planning details appear directly below.

board note of kageg-bahof: The renewal with Holwynax Holdings closes at $2 million a year, 5 percent below the last contract. Project Ulaath slips by two quarters because of the supplier delay.

## v3.2.0 — Veristack plugin system

Renamed the validator plugin auth setting for consistency with the rest of the Veristack config surface. The old name is still read with a deprecation warning and will be removed in v4.0. Release managers should update deployment env files before cutting the next release. The renamed setting, which holds the plugin registry credential, now appears as the line below.

vault entry, yajop-fajof: VAULT_KEY8=82c6da7e

Runbook: Sievekeeper bloom filter fronting the Ashmont KV store. If miss-rate alarms fire, check filter saturation first; above 70% fill, false positives spike and reads hammer the store. Rebuild the filter from the nightly key manifest — takes ~8 minutes, reads degrade but don't fail. Never disable the filter under load; the store cannot absorb raw traffic. Confirm saturation drops after rebuild, then close the alert. The rebuild trace is recorded below.

trace token, fafog-kageg: htk4_98e6

**Action item: Harden Sievewright validator plugin loading.** Root cause: a third-party validator threw during registration and silently disabled the whole chain. Fix: plugins must declare a version-pinned manifest and pass the new conformance suite before load. Deadline: next release cut. The manifest schema and conformance suite instructions are published on the internal page.

dashboard of kafof-tahaf = https://confluence.tolvaqsys.internal/projects/browse/display/a1250987